Output 61942012e34a19b26bb01fac10699b7906988911d9526b075ae9e0c84dfb5271:1

value
17744106
script pubkey
OP_0 OP_PUSHBYTES_20 e829e837300492809d4f5852ded4fe24eae95a81
address
bc1qaq57sdesqjfgp820tpfda487yn4wjk5pnh3l7g
transaction
61942012e34a19b26bb01fac10699b7906988911d9526b075ae9e0c84dfb5271